Eighth seed and home favourite Jessica Pegula will lock horns with two-time quarterfinalist and 21st seed Petra Kvitova in the Round of 16 at the US Open on Monday. The American has shown terrific consistency all season. She reached the quarterfinals at the Australian Open and Roland Garros, establishing herself in the big league. Wih a run to the semifinals in Miami on hardcourt and the final at Madrid on clay, Pegula has shown her versatility and adaptibility to different surfaces. The World No. 8 has come to the US Open after making the semifinals in Toronto and the last eight in Cincinnati. While Pegula blitzed through her first two rounds at her 'home' Slam, dispatching Viktorija Golubic and Aliaksandra Sasnovich in straight sets, she faced a stern test against Chinese qualifier Yue Yuan in the third round on Saturday. Meanwhile, two-time Wimbledon champion Petra Kvitova mightily struggled in the first half of the season, posting a 10-13 win-loss record. She, however, turned her season around on grass, winning the Eastbourne title. Although her Wimbledon campaign ended in the third round, the 32-year-old caught fire in Cincinnati, where she won five matches before losing to Caroline Garcia in the final. The World No. 21 started her New York campaign with a 7-6(3), 6-0 win over Erika Andreeva. After a walkover against Anhelina Kalinina in the second round, Kvitova squared off against fellow two-time Grand Slam champion Garbine Muguruza in a blockbuster third-round clash on Saturday.
